Performance Stage Fright
Stage fright can become a major issue for many when performing in a public setting. When this becomes the case, simply take a deep breath and count to ten. Encouragement is a very important factor when performing for the first time. You may want to invite friends and family to attend your karaoke performance for emotional support. It will help you to perform at your best when you are surrounded by people with a positive outlook on your performance and style. This will give you the courage to perform.
Distortion of Sound
Distortion and loud vibrations have become an unwanted inconvenience for some karaoke singers who are starting out. Many people unintentionally sing too loud and too close to the microphone which will cause distorted noises. Distortion can also lead to feedback issues which will ruin your performance. The best solution to solve this problem is keeping the microphone at least four inches away from your mouth. You will also want to keep a distance between your microphone and the sound system to get an excellent quality of sound.
